#6cfb67 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6cfb67 is composed of 42.4% red, 98.4%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57% cyan, 0% magenta, 59%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 118 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 69.4%. #6cfb67 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8ffce with #00f700.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#6cfb67

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#edffed is the lightest one.

Tones of #6cfb67

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afb3af is the less saturated color, while #6cfb67 is the most saturated one.
